ISLAMABAD: Minister for Religious Affairs and Interfaith Harmony Sardar Muhammad Yousaf Thursday said that the Friday's Hajj balloting has been cancelled for ensuring transparency.
In a statement he said new dates of balloting will be announced in light of Supreme Court's orders.
According to details the Supreme Court has ordered the ministry to refrain from issuing results of balloting on Friday. But the minister has decided to cancel balloting till decision of Supreme Court.
The new date of balloting will be announced in the light of Supreme Court's decision.
According to ministry 280,617 applications have been received and 83,440 pilgrims will be selected through a transparent balloting.
